芽孢杆菌对水生动物抗病力影响的研究进展 被引量:1

Research advancement of Bacillus sp. on the disease resistance in aquatic animals

摘要 芽孢杆菌在水生动物肠道内可以大量耗氧形成厌氧环境,抑制其体内病原菌的生长,还可以产生抗生素类物质,从而降低水生动物发病的可能性。本文主要综述芽孢杆菌对水生动物抗病力的影响及其可能的机制。 Bacillus sp. can suppress the growth of pathogenic bacteria around aquatic animal mainly through producing antibiotics and consuming oxygen to form anaerobic condition.This paper mainly reviewed the effects of Bacillus sp. on disease resistance in aquatic animals and its probable mechanism.
